How do you present Peanuts creator Charles Schulz's legacy to the general public? What exactly does a museum curator do?
Join Tiffany Babb as she speaks to Charles M. Schulz Museum and Research Center curator Benjamin L. Clark about the life of being a museum curator, what it's like to preserve a legend's legacy, and why he wishes he had access to bigger gallery rooms.
